CUEVAS ALBARRAN, Valeria Betzabé; MOO XIX, Francisco Javier  and  SAURI PALMA, Maricela. Social perception of the implementation of a project of cultural tourism in the community of Sacalaca. El periplo sustentable [online]. 2016, n.30, pp.206-224. ISSN 1870-9036.

The development of economic activity in most rural communities in Quintana Roo is conditioned by the characteristics of the surrounding environment as well as the limited infrastructure available. Introducing pristine features that allow the use of cultural tourism, an assessment was developed to determine the perception of the communities surrounding Sacalaca, Quintana Roo, order to identify interest in adopting this strategy of sustainable business. The process consisted of closed questionnaires to nine neighboring communities, which identified as positive the perception of this activity as a source of employment and income generation.

Keywords : Tourism; culture; development; perception; sustainable.
